Bade Miyan Chote Miyan Box Office collection had a promising start on its first day, earning over ₹15 crore in India, according to source Sacnilk.com. Directed by Ali Abbas Zafar, the film debuted on Eid and amassed ₹15.5 crore nett across all languages. With a 29.30% Hindi occupancy on Thursday, the movie is backed by producers Vashu Bhagnani, Deepshikha Deshmukh, Jackky Bhagnani, Himanshu Kishan Mehra, and Ali Abbas Zafar.

Starring Akshay Kumar, Prithviraj Sukumaran, Sonakshi Sinha, Manushi Chillar, and Alaya F, Bade Miyan Chote Miyan is an action-packed entertainer described by Akshay as akin to “Bad Boys.” Produced with a budget exceeding Rs 300 crore by Vashu Bhagnani and Jackky Bhagnani, the film draws its title from the 1998 original featuring Amitabh Bachchan and Govinda, though sharing no similarities beyond the name. Bade Miyan Chote Miyan Box Office Collection is off to a promising start at the box office. The film is estimated to have earned Rs 15.50 crore net at the domestic box office. Worldwide, the film has minted Rs 36.33 crore. As per reports, it recorded an overall occupancy of 30.35 percent on April 11 in India.

 

Akshay Kumar And Tiger Shroff At Box Office 

Akshay Kumar reflected on his film journey, acknowledging both successes and failures and expressing optimism for Bade Miyan Chote Miyan’s prospects. Despite recent box office setbacks, he remains resilient, citing past experiences of overcoming adversity, including a period of 16 consecutive flops. His recent cameo in OMG 2 marked a turning point amid a series of underperforming films like Ram Setu, Raksha Bandhan, and Samrat Prithviraj.

As for Tiger Shroff, his cinematic efforts since Baaghi 3 in 2020 have struggled to repeat earlier hits. Heropanti 2 and Ganapath fell short at the box office, underscoring the challenging landscape he faces post-lockdown.
